Are there any financial assistance programs available for seniors seeking assisted living in Sioux County?
There may be financial assistance programs in Iowa that may help seniors cover the costs of assisted living in Sioux County. Programs like Iowa Medicaid and Supplemental Security Income (SSI) may offer assistance based on financial eligibility and specific criteria. Veterans may also be eligible for aid through the Veterans Aid and Attendance Benefit. It's recommended to contact the relevant agencies or consult with a financial advisor to explore these options and determine eligibility.
What is the difference between assisted living and nursing homes in Sioux County?
Assisted living and nursing homes in Sioux County, IA serve different needs. Assisted living provides assistance with daily activities and offers a more independent living environment, whereas nursing homes offer 24/7 medical care and are suitable for those with more complex medical needs. Nursing homes are typically for individuals who require skilled nursing care, while assisted living is for seniors who need help with daily tasks but do not require constant medical attention.
What should I consider when choosing an assisted living facility in Sioux County, IA?
When selecting an assisted living facility in Sioux County, you should consider factors such as the location, cost, services provided, staff qualifications, safety measures, and resident reviews. Visit the facility in person to assess the environment and talk to staff and residents. Ask about the admission process, contract terms, and any additional fees. It's essential to choose a facility that aligns with your specific needs and preferences, so thorough research and visits are crucial.
